Feng Shui (pronounced "fung shway"), which means "wind and water," is an ancient Chinese practice that focuses on creating harmony between people and their environment. It’s based on the idea that invisible energy, called "Qi" (pronounced "chee"), flows through everything. This concept is similar to the Indian "Prana" or the Western idea of "life force."
Unlike Westerners who often see space as just a physical container, Feng Shui views the environment as a living system. It teaches that the layout of buildings, furniture arrangement, and even the position of objects can influence Qi flow—affecting health, wealth, relationships, and even destiny. Harvard professor Ezra Vogel describes it as "China’s poetic way of understanding space, a unique environmental psychology."

Equilibrium
Feng Shui is built on three key principles:
- Qi (Energy): The life force that connects all living things
- Yin & Yang: The balance of opposites (light/dark, soft/hard)
- Five Elements: Wood, Fire, Earth, Metal, Water—each representing different energies
The goal is to create spaces that "store wind and gather water"—balancing natural energies for well-being. As Ming Dynasty master Jiang Da Hong wrote: "Qi scatters with wind but settles by water. Ancient masters learned to gather and guide it—that’s Feng Shui."
